HarmonyOS鸿蒙Next中video(JS)组件打开视频文件失败

HarmonyOS鸿蒙Next中video(JS)组件打开视频文件失败 在HarmonyOS鸿蒙Next中,使用JS的<video>组件打开视频文件失败,可能涉及以下原因:

  1. 文件路径问题:确保视频文件路径正确,且文件存在于指定位置。路径错误或文件缺失会导致加载失败。

  2. 文件格式不支持:鸿蒙系统支持的视频格式有限,常见如MP4、H.264等。若视频格式不在支持范围内,将无法播放。

  3. 权限问题:应用可能缺少访问视频文件的权限。需在config.json中配置相应权限,如ohos.permission.READ_MEDIA

  4. 网络问题:若视频文件来自网络,需确保网络连接正常,且服务器可访问。网络不稳定或服务器问题会导致加载失败。

  5. 组件属性配置错误:检查<video>组件的srcautoplay等属性是否正确配置。属性错误可能导致组件无法正常加载视频。

  6. 系统资源限制:设备内存或CPU资源不足时,可能导致视频加载失败。需确保设备有足够资源运行应用。

  7. 鸿蒙系统版本兼容性:某些视频功能可能仅在特定鸿蒙系统版本中支持。需确认应用与系统版本兼容。

  8. 代码逻辑错误:检查JS代码中是否存在逻辑错误,如事件监听未正确绑定或回调函数未正确处理。

  9. 视频文件损坏:视频文件本身可能已损坏,导致无法正常播放。可尝试使用其他视频文件进行测试。

  10. 系统Bug:鸿蒙系统可能存在未修复的Bug,导致视频组件无法正常工作。需关注系统更新,及时修复已知问题。

以上是可能导致<video>组件打开视频文件失败的常见原因。


更多关于HarmonyOS鸿蒙Next中video(JS)组件打开视频文件失败的实战教程也可以访问 https://www.itying.com/category-93-b0.html

1 回复

更多关于HarmonyOS鸿蒙Next中video(JS)组件打开视频文件失败的实战系列教程也可以访问 https://www.itying.com/category-93-b0.html


在HarmonyOS鸿蒙Next中,使用video(JS)组件打开视频文件失败,可能原因包括:

  1. 文件路径错误:确保视频文件路径正确,且文件存在于指定位置。
  2. 格式不支持:检查视频格式是否被video组件支持,如MP4、WebM等。
  3. 权限问题:确认应用已获取访问存储或网络资源的权限。
  4. 资源加载失败:网络视频需确保URL可访问,本地视频需确保文件完整。
  5. 组件属性配置:检查srcautoplay等属性是否正确设置。

建议逐一排查以上问题,确保视频文件可正常加载和播放。

回到顶部